From 11773d6a02cc13b288803f4a507a4fadb4edef47 Mon Sep 17 00:00:00 2001 From: guilhermesalomone-87 Date: Fri, 14 Nov 2025 17:09:57 -0300 Subject: [PATCH 1/2] Update openapi.yaml M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Correção nos exemplos de resposta dos endpoints POST `/cobr` e PUT `/cobr/{txid}` para conformidade com o schema `CobRGerada`, removendo os campos `politicaRetentativa` --- openapi.yaml | 27 +++++++++++++++++++++++++-- 1 file changed, 25 insertions(+), 2 deletions(-) diff --git a/openapi.yaml b/openapi.yaml index dbcbc4a..6f4bc1e 100644 --- a/openapi.yaml +++ b/openapi.yaml @@ -2625,7 +2625,7 @@ paths: $ref: "#/components/schemas/CobRGerada" examples: response1: - $ref: "#/components/examples/cobRResponse2" + $ref: "#/components/examples/cobRResponse1Gerada" "400": description: "Requisição com formato inválido." content: @@ -2722,7 +2722,7 @@ paths: $ref: "#/components/schemas/CobRGerada" examples: response1: - $ref: "#/components/examples/cobRResponse1" + $ref: "#/components/examples/cobRResponse1Gerada" "400": description: "Requisição com formato inválido." content: @@ -3046,6 +3046,29 @@ components: summary: "Exemplo de revisão de cobrança recorrente 1" value: status: CANCELADA + cobRResponse1Gerada: + summary: "Exemplo de cobrança recorrente 1 - Gerada" + value: + idRec: RR1234567820240115abcdefghijk + txid: 3136957d93134f2184b369e8f1c0729d + infoAdicional: "Serviços de Streamming de Música e Filmes." + calendario: + criacao: "2024-04-01" + dataDeVencimento: "2024-04-15" + status: CRIADA + valor: + original: "106.07" + ajusteDiaUtil: true + devedor: + cep: "89256-140" + cidade: "Uberlândia" + email: "sebastiao.tavares@mail.com" + logradouro: "Alameda Franco 1056" + uf: "MG" + recebedor: + agencia: "9708" + conta: "012682" + tipoConta: CORRENTE cobRResponse1: summary: "Exemplo de cobrança recorrente 1" value: From c0a842183288eb7bd522d419eb50af80cab2afbd Mon Sep 17 00:00:00 2001 From: guilhermesalomone-87 Date: Fri, 14 Nov 2025 17:44:11 -0300 Subject: [PATCH 2/2] =?UTF-8?q?Remo=C3=A7=C3=A3o=20do=20exemplo=20`cobRRes?= =?UTF-8?q?ponse1`=20que=20n=C3=A3o=20estava=20sendo=20utilizado=20e=20era?= =?UTF-8?q?=20redundante.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- openapi.yaml | 27 --------------------------- 1 file changed, 27 deletions(-) diff --git a/openapi.yaml b/openapi.yaml index 6f4bc1e..5560cc6 100644 --- a/openapi.yaml +++ b/openapi.yaml @@ -3069,33 +3069,6 @@ components: agencia: "9708" conta: "012682" tipoConta: CORRENTE - cobRResponse1: - summary: "Exemplo de cobrança recorrente 1" - value: - idRec: RR1234567820240115abcdefghijk - txid: 3136957d93134f2184b369e8f1c0729d - infoAdicional: "Serviços de Streamming de Música e Filmes." - calendario: - criacao: "2024-04-01" - dataDeVencimento: "2024-04-15" - status: CRIADA - valor: - original: "106.07" - politicaRetentativa: PERMITE_3R_7D - ajusteDiaUtil: true - devedor: - cep: "89256-140" - cidade: "Uberlândia" - email: "sebastiao.tavares@mail.com" - logradouro: "Alameda Franco 1056" - uf: "MG" - recebedor: - agencia: "9708" - conta: "012682" - tipoConta: CORRENTE - atualizacao: - - data: "2024-04-01T14:47:29.470Z" - status: CRIADA cobRResponse2: summary: "Exemplo de cobrança recorrente 1" value: